存储服务器及其实现方法

    公开(公告)号:CN105451028A

    公开(公告)日:2016-03-30

    申请号:CN201510881917.1

    申请日:2015-12-03

    摘要: 本申请公开了一种存储服务器及其实现方法,该方法包括如下步骤:S1、Web服务器与存储服务器建立通讯;S2、Web服务器向存储服务器发送开始存储命令;S3、存储服务器接收到开始存储命令后,创建与DVR设备的数据通道一一对应的接收通道;S4、每个接收通道向对应的DVR设备的对应通道进行视频码流请求,视频码流数据通过对应的接收通道写入外部磁盘设备;S5、Web服务器向存储服务器发送停止存储命令;S6、存储服务器接收到停止存储命令后,每个接收通道向对应的DVR设备的对应通道停止进行视频码流请求;S7、存储服务器销毁与DVR设备的数据通道一一对应的接收通道。本发明的存储服务器能同时对300至400路视频码流进行存储,从而提高了存储服务器的存储性能。

    存储服务器
    2.
    实用新型

    公开(公告)号:CN205405483U

    公开(公告)日:2016-07-27

    申请号:CN201520996098.0

    申请日:2015-12-03

    IPC分类号: G06F3/06 H04N7/18

    摘要: 本申请公开了一种存储服务器,其包括设置在存储服务器外部的Web服务器、DVR设备和磁盘设备,以及设置在存储服务器内部的监听控制模块、接收模块、设备缓存模块和写入模块;Web服务器与监听控制模块网络连接,监听控制模块分别与接收模块和写入模块通信连接,接收模块包括动态创建的接收结构体和通道结构体,写入模块包括动态创建的写入结构体和写入线程;接收模块与DVR设备通信连接,设备缓存模块包括静态分配的设备结构体和缓存区,设备结构体分别与通道结构体和写入结构体相连接,写入结构体还和缓存区相连。视频数据由DVR设备进入存储服务器后,经过对应的数据通道直接将视频数据写入磁盘设备。从而提高了存储服务器的存储性能。